Here are the main considerations to keep in mind before making your decision.Size and Compatibility
Ensure the panel size fits your shower space. Larger panels with multiple jets offer more luxurious coverage but require sufficient wall and ceiling clearance. Compatibility with existing plumbing is also critical; check if your water pressure supports high-performance jets or if a pressure booster is needed. Consider whether the panel’s dimensions match your shower stall for a seamless fit, avoiding awkward gaps or installation challenges.
Material Durability and Build Quality
High-quality materials like stainless steel or anodized aluminum resist corrosion and stand up better over time, especially in humid environments. Cheaper plastic panels may crack or degrade faster but often come at a lower initial cost. Weigh the long-term benefits of durability against your budget, and remember that investing in solid materials can reduce maintenance and replacement costs.
Water Pressure and Spray Modes
Most rainfall shower panels require adequate water pressure to function properly. Look for models that specify their pressure range, especially if your home has low water pressure. Multiple spray modes—such as rainfall, waterfall, and massage jets—offer customization but may impact pressure and flow. Consider your preferences for massage jets versus rainfall coverage to select a setup that feels balanced and satisfying.
Additional Features and Controls
Features like LED lighting, digital temperature displays, and handheld sprayers enhance convenience and luxury but often increase cost. Decide which extras are worth the investment based on your daily routines. For example, digital controls can improve temperature accuracy, while LED lighting adds ambiance. Be wary of overly complex setups if you prefer simple, straightforward operation.
Ease of Installation and Maintenance
Some panels come pre-assembled or with straightforward mounting instructions, saving time and effort. Others may require professional installation, especially larger or more complex models. Maintenance considerations include easy access to jets and filters, as well as corrosion-resistant finishes. Choosing a design that aligns with your DIY comfort level can prevent frustration and additional costs.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I install a rainfall shower panel system myself?
Many rainfall shower panels are designed for DIY installation, especially those with straightforward mounting brackets and minimal plumbing modifications. However, models with complex features like digital controls or multiple jets may require professional help. Before attempting installation, review the product instructions carefully, and consider your own plumbing skills to avoid leaks or improper fittings that could lead to damage or reduced performance.
Will a rainfall shower panel work well with low water pressure?
Rainfall shower panels generally perform best with moderate to high water pressure, as they rely on steady flow to produce the desired rainfall effect. If your home has low water pressure, look for models specifically rated for such conditions or consider installing a pressure booster. Some panels include adjustable flow settings or smaller jets that can help optimize performance in low-pressure environments.
Are LED or digital features worth the extra cost?
LED lighting and digital temperature controls add a level of convenience and luxury, enhancing your shower experience. If you value precise temperature adjustments or ambient lighting, these features justify their price. However, they can increase complexity and maintenance needs, so consider whether their benefits align with your daily routine and willingness to manage additional system components.
How important is material quality for longevity?
Material quality directly impacts the lifespan and appearance of your shower panel. Premium metals like stainless steel resist corrosion and maintain their finish longer, especially in humid environments. Cheaper plastics may crack or discolor over time, leading to more frequent replacements. Investing in high-quality materials can result in better durability and lower maintenance costs over the long run.
What’s the best way to choose a panel size?
Measure your shower area carefully to select a panel that fits comfortably without overwhelming the space. Larger panels with multiple jets provide more coverage but require ample room and proper support. If your shower stall is small, opt for a more compact model that still offers satisfying rainfall coverage. Balancing size with your bathroom layout ensures a functional, aesthetic upgrade.
